James Burgess jrb at pixar.com
Thu Mar 10 17:15:27 PST 2016

 It has been a very long time since I have posted here (WiX has been doing it’s job admirably) but I’m kind of stumped on this one. Excuse me for referring to a really old version of WiX, it’s just been working for years so I’ve had no reason to touch it.

A couple of newish machines running Windows 8.1 Pro (Windows Installer 5.0.9600.17905) in our office can’t build MSI’s because the output from tallow.exe is different. The difference is that it only writes the Name attribute even if the file doesn’t have an 8.3 name. We have other machines which are basically identical that do not have this issue even when pointed at the exact same directory structure. I’m imagining that something is installed on these machines that is making the difference (C# runtime?) but I don’t know enough about C# to even begin to figure out what that might be. Any ideas?

- James

